Intel HEXL for FPGA
Intel Homomorphic Encryption FPGA Acceleration Library, accelerating the modular arithmetic operations used in homomorphic encryption.
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Public Member Functions | List of all members
dyadic_multiply_test Class Reference
Inheritance diagram for dyadic_multiply_test:

Public Member Functions

void test_dyadic_multiply (uint64_t num_dyadic_multiply, uint64_t num_moduli, uint64_t coeff_count, bool death=false)
 
void test_matrix_dyadic_multiply (uint64_t n_rows, uint64_t n_columns, uint64_t num_moduli, uint64_t coeff_count)
 
void TestBody () override
 

Member Function Documentation

void dyadic_multiply_test::test_dyadic_multiply ( uint64_t  num_dyadic_multiply,
uint64_t  num_moduli,
uint64_t  coeff_count,
bool  death = false 
)
void dyadic_multiply_test::test_matrix_dyadic_multiply ( uint64_t  n_rows,
uint64_t  n_columns,
uint64_t  num_moduli,
uint64_t  coeff_count 
)
void dyadic_multiply_test::TestBody ( )
inlineoverride

The documentation for this class was generated from the following file: